Commercial Description:
Brewed to honor the brave souls who kept our brew pub open in the early 90’s while wrecking balls tore down the mall around us. Dry and smooth, with a grassy, citrus aroma and a honey malt middle. Brew House notes Style: Belgian Style Golden Ale Alcohol by Volume: 6.7% IBU’s: 45 Hops: Saaz, Chinook Malt: Pilzen Cellarman’s Notes. Demolition will remain fresh 180 days from the bottled on date. Unfiltered, so a light chill haze should be expected. Some yeast may settle in the bottom of the bottle, decant gently.

Bottle from June ’05. Cloudy orange with a frothy white diminishing head. Aroma of citrusy hops, apple, pear, some soapy yeast and alcohol. Sweet malt flavor mostly but also hops, some residual yeast and alcohol. Smooth palate. Peppery spice finish with some alcohol warmth in the throat. Pretty good. Probably would be even better if I aged the bottle for a few years as the label suggests, but I’m not that patient with my beer.

Pours orange-gold with a small white head. Lots of orange, citrus and honey aroma and some woodiness. Loads of honey sweet malts in the flavor some floral hops, grapefruit and a touch of lemon. Finishes with a hint of oak. Thin body with lots of alcohol on the finish.
